In Dagestan, trial in Zarema Bagautdinova's case to be held behind closed doors
The trial in the case against Zarema Bagautdinova, a member of the Dagestani Regional Public Organization (DRPO) "Pravozaschita" (Advocacy), will be held behind closed doors.
Let us remind you that Zarema Bagautdinova is accused of aiding and abetting terrorist activities. The defendant may be sentenced to 10 years of imprisonment.
During the today's court session, the Buynaksk City Court has pronounced the decision to extend the arrest of Zarema Bagautdinova for two months. This was told to the "Caucasian Knot" correspondent by Ziyavutdin Uvaisov, Chairman of the Advocates' Chamber "Tradition".
According to the advocate, the court session has also considered the motion filed by the prosecutors, who asked to conduct all further court session behind closed doors, since some data associated with the criminal case are of operating secrecy.
The "Caucasian Knot" has reported that on July 4, Zarema Bagautdinova was detained in Buynaksk. According to her advocate Abdulla Gaziev, she was detained under the testimonies of two detained residents of Buynaksk, in whose houses weapons and grenades were found.
